BABYFEN ESSENTIAL OIL 20ML CARVI GIFRER

Babyfen laboratories Gifrer is a dietary supplement based Caraway.

Description Babyfen caraway essential oil

Babyfen is recommended in case of stomach cramps, flatulence and bloating in infants and children.

It is traditionally used to treat colitis (and colic) in infants.

Council use Babyfen caraway essential oil

Generally 2 drops per kg three times per day.
From 3 to 6 years 30 drops three times daily.
From 6 years, 50 drops 3 times a day

Composition of essential oil of caraway Babyfen

Formulated with essential oil of Caraway (2.5%).

Carefully use Babyfen caraway essential oil

Food supplements should be used as part of a healthy lifestyle and not be
used as substitutes for a varied and balanced diet.

Consult your pharmacist or your doctor.
